Reinhold Niebuhr, famous Christian philosopher, writer, and author, will speak in Memorial Church tomorrow at 11 a.m. at the usual morning service.
Niebuhr, now associate professor of ethics at Union Theological Seminary in New York City, is one of the visiting clergymen regularly scheduled to speak by the Memorial Church.
Among Niebuhr's more notable books are, "Does Civilization Need Religion?" and "Faith and History." He is editor of "Christianity and Crisis," and contributing editor to "The Nation."
